Match the following phytochemicals with their main food source.
A. Flavonoids
B. Allyl sulfides/organosulfurs
C. Anthocyanosides
D. Resveratrol
E. Phytosterols/isoflavones
F. Carotenoids
G. Lignans
A. Citrus fruit, tea, chocolate
B. Garlic, onions, leek
C. Red, blue, and purple plants (blueberries, eggplant)
D. Grapes, peanuts, red wine
E. Soybeans, legumes
F. Orange, red, and yellow fruits and vegetables
G. Flaxseed, berries, whole grains
